MPI并行计算性能的研究

摘    要:探索了一种基于Windows系统平台的、用于实现高性能计算的MPI并行环境.采用MPI最新版本MPICH2-1.0.6作为并行计算的支撑环境,通过编制的三个具有代表性的MPI并行计算程序,并在以100M bps交换式局域网作为互连的机群上和具有双核处理器的PC机上分别进行了并行效率的实际测试,得到了预期结果,并做了相应分析.

Research on the performance of MPI parallel computing

Abstract:A MPI(Message Passing Interface) parallel environment for high performance computing based on Windows platform is presented in article. Its parallel computing is controlled and supported by MPICH2 software, a latest version of MPI implementation. And a highspeed 100Mb/s Ethernet network interconnects all PCs. Tests using three parallel computing programs measure the parallel efficiency of the systems which are the PC cluster and Dual Core Processor PCs. At last, The results which are expected are analyzed and compared.
